Climate Change: 'Magic Bullet' Carbon Solution Takes Big Step:

A technology that removes carbon dioxide from the air has received significant backing from major fossil fuel companies.

British Columbia-based Carbon Engineering has shown that it can extract CO2 in a cost-effective way.

It has now been boosted by $68m in new investment from Chevron, Occidental and coal giant BHP.

[...]CO2 is a powerful warming gas but there's not a lot of it in the atmosphere - for every million molecules of air, there are 410 of CO2.

While the CO2 is helping to drive temperatures up around the world, the comparatively low concentrations make it difficult to design efficient machines to remove the gas.

Carbon Engineering's process is all about sucking in air and exposing it to a chemical solution that concentrates the CO2. Further refinements mean the gas can be purified into a form that can be stored or utilised as a liquid fuel.

[...]Carbon Engineering's barn-sized installation has a large fan in the middle of the roof which draws in air from the atmosphere.

It then comes into contact with a hydroxide-based chemical solution. Certain hydroxides react with carbon dioxide, reversibly binding to the CO2 molecule. When the CO2 in the air reacts with the liquid, it forms a carbonate mixture. That is then treated with a slurry of calcium hydroxide to change it into solid form; the slurry helps form tiny pellets of calcium carbonate.

The chalky calcium carbonate pellets are then treated at a high temperature of about 900C, with the pellets decomposing into a CO2 stream and calcium oxide.

After any water lingering in the concentrated CO2 is removed, the result can be converted into a fuel:

The captured CO2 is mixed with hydrogen that's made from water and green electricity. It's then passed over a catalyst at 900C to form carbon monoxide. Adding in more hydrogen to the carbon monoxide turns it into what's called synthesis gas.

Finally a Fischer-Tropsch process turns this gas into a synthetic crude oil. Carbon Engineering says the liquid can be used in a variety of engines without modification.
